প্রাণবন্ত - আপস্টার্টের সাথে সংযোগ করতে ব্যর্থ: সংযোগ প্রত্যাখ্যান করা


51

ডু-রিলিজ-আপগ্রেডের মাধ্যমে সবেমাত্র আপডেট হয়েছে এবং এখন ব্যর্থ2ban এবং প্ল্লেক্সমিডিয়াসভারের মতো নির্দিষ্ট কিছু আপস্টার্ট কাজ শুরু হবে না (পুনরায় ইনস্টল করার চেষ্টা করেছেন)

$ sudo service fail2ban start
Job for fail2ban.service failed. See "systemctl status fail2ban.service" and "journalctl -xe" for details.

$ systemctl status fail2ban.service
  fail2ban.service - Fail2Ban Service
   Loaded: loaded (/lib/systemd/system/fail2ban.service; enabled; vendor preset: enabled)
   Active: failed (Result: start-limit) since Mon 2015-04-27 19:47:27 BST; 26s ago
     Docs: man:fail2ban(1)
  Process: 14423 ExecStart=/usr/bin/fail2ban-client -x start (code=exited, status=255)

$ sudo service plexmediaserver start
Failed to start plexmediaserver.service: Unit plexmediaserver.service failed to load: No such file or directory.

$ sudo dpkg -i plexmediaserver_0.9.11.16.958-80f1748_amd64.deb
(Reading database ... 88738 files and directories currently installed.)
Preparing to unpack plexmediaserver_0.9.11.16.958-80f1748_amd64.deb ...
stop: Unable to connect to Upstart: Failed to connect to socket /com/ubuntu/upstart: Connection refused

এই দিয়ে শুরু করার সাথে কোন ধারণা?


আপনি কি /lib/systemd/system/fail2ban.serviceআপনার পোস্টে বিষয়বস্তু যুক্ত করতে পারেন ? failed (Result: start-limit)ইঙ্গিত করে যে সেবা ক্রমাগত ব্যর্থ হচ্ছে এবং পুনর্সূচনা বের করার চেষ্টা করে এবং systemdসীমিত করা হয় কতবার এটি একটি নির্দিষ্ট সময়ের মধ্যে শুরু হয়। এই বাগ রিপোর্টটি প্রাসঙ্গিক কিনা তাও ভাবছেন ।
TheSchwa

উত্তর:


54

systemdডেস্কটপ এবং সার্ভার সহ সমস্ত স্বাদের জন্য উবুন্টু 15.04 সালে তার পরিষেবা কাঠামো হিসাবে স্যুইচ করেছে। প্রস্তাবিত অনুশীলনটি হ'ল আপনার upstartচাকরিগুলিকে চাকরিতে পরিবর্তন করা systemd(আরও তথ্যের জন্য উইকি নিবন্ধটি দেখুন)। আপনি চাইলে ফিরে যেতেও upstartপারেন, এটি অবশ্যই দ্রুত সমাধান। আমি আপনাকে পরামর্শ দিচ্ছি যে উইকি নিবন্ধের প্রথম কয়েকটি বিভাগ আপনার পক্ষে মতামতগুলি ওজন করতে হবে।

প্রস্তাবিত ফিক্স

আপনার upstartস্ক্রিপ্টগুলিতে স্থানান্তর করতে উইকি নিবন্ধটি দেখুন systemd

আলোচনা এবং কোডিং গাইড: আপস্টার্ট ব্যবহারকারীদের জন্য সিস্টেমড

দ্রুত সমাধান (কেবল 15.04 এর জন্য)

স্থায়ীভাবে upstartকেবল চালাতে ফিরে যেতে :

sudo apt-get install upstart-sysv
sudo update-initramfs -u
sudo reboot

সম্পাদনা: উইকি নিবন্ধটি কেবল 15.04 এর জন্য এটির প্রস্তাব দেয়, তবে কিছু ব্যবহারকারী এটি 16.04-তেও সহায়ক বলে মনে করেছেন।


1
systemd14.10 থেকে আপগ্রেড করা সিস্টেমে নিশ্চয়ই নতুন ইনস্টলড সিস্টেমে কেবলমাত্র ডিফল্ট?
জোস

1
আউটপুট আপনি পোস্ট এ পুরো বিষয়টা বিস্তারিত বিবেচনা গ্রহণ, কাজ দৃশ্যত ব্যবহার শুরু করার চেষ্টা করছে systemdএবং upstart। লক্ষ্য করুন যে systemctlবেশ কয়েকবার উল্লেখ করা হয়েছে, যা কমান্ড লাইন ইন্টারফেস systemd। তদ্ব্যতীত, Failed to connect to socketত্রুটিটি বোঝায় যে upstartমোটেই চলমান নয়। দেখে মনে হচ্ছে fail2banএটি ব্যবহার করার চেষ্টা করছে systemdতবে স্ক্রিপ্টটিতে একটি ত্রুটি রয়েছে এবং plexmediaserverএটি ব্যবহার করার চেষ্টা করছে upstartযা আর বিদ্যমান নেই।
TheSchwa

3
এখন কি আপস্টার্ট বন্ধ রয়েছে? আমি কেবল নতুন পরিষেবাদি তৈরি করা কতটা সহজ তা পছন্দ করেছি ..
কাপ্পে

6
দ্রুত ফিক্সটি আমার উবুন্টু ইনস্টলটিকে স্ক্রু করে (১.0.০৪) রুট প্রম্পট এবং টাইপ সহ পুনরুদ্ধার মোডে বুট করতে হয়েছিল: apt-get remove upstart-sysvএবং update-initramfs -uসমস্ত কিছু আবার কাজ করার জন্য
JqueryToAddNumbers

1
আমার সাথে এটিও ঘটেছে, @ এক্সপ্লেশনস্লেয়ার। নির্দেশাবলীর জন্য আপনাকে ধন্যবাদ।
রবিন জিম্মারম্যান 21

5

আমি ব্যর্থ হয়েছে যে কনফিগারেশন ফাইলে ব্যর্থ 2ban এর জন্য সমস্যা ছিল: /etc/fail2ban/jail.local

প্যাম বিভাগে, পোর্ট ভেরিয়েবলটি দুটিবার তালিকাভুক্ত করা হয়

[pam-generic]

...

port     = all
banaction = iptables-allports
port     = anyport

যদিও এই বিভাগটি enabled = falseআমার কনফিগারেশনে অক্ষম করা হয়েছে ( ), এটি একটি ত্রুটির কারণ ঘটায়। আমি কেবল এই দ্বিতীয় সংজ্ঞাটি মন্তব্য করেছি

# port     = anyport

আমি এটি ম্যানুয়ালি ব্যর্থ2ban চালিয়ে পেয়েছি:

sudo fail2ban-client start

আমি এটি পেয়েছিলাম। আমার ধারণা সংস্করণগুলির মধ্যে উদাহরণগুলির কনফিগারগুলি সামঞ্জস্যপূর্ণ নয়।
অ্যাশ

1

এখানে সমাধান। এটি সাম্প্রতিক ভার্চুয়ালবক্স আপডেট সম্পর্কে।

টার্মিনালে চালান ( Ctrl+ Alt+ F1যদি আপনি পুনরুদ্ধার মোড থেকে অ্যাক্সেস করছেন):

sudo apt-get purge virtualbox-guest-x11

0

আমার ক্ষেত্রে যেখানে উবুন্টু সংস্করণটি আপগ্রেড করা হয়েছিল, সেখানে নতুন উবুন্টু সংস্করণের ক্ষেত্রে আমরা কমান্ডটি চালিত করেছি just

নতুন কমান্ড যা কাজ করে:

 sudo service ssh restart

টিসিপি 22 পোর্টে শুনছে তা পরীক্ষা করতে, আপনাকে এই আদেশটি থেকে কিছু আউটপুট পাওয়া উচিত: sudo netstat -anp | grep sshd

Ssh চলছে তা পরীক্ষা করতে:

  1. Eval ssh-agent
  2. ps -aux | grep ssh

দ্রষ্টব্য: আমরা বিবেচনা করছি যে ssh প্রবর্তন করা হচ্ছে এমন বাক্স থেকে ssh এজেন্টের মধ্যে ssh- এর প্রয়োজনীয় কীটি লোড করা হয়েছে এবং ssh সম্পন্ন করা বাক্সটিতে কীটি .ssh/authorized_keysফাইলটি যুক্ত করা হয়েছে।


-3

লিনাক্স ভিএম (ভার্চুয়ালবক্স) আপগ্রেড করার পরে আমার এই সমস্যা হয়েছিল।

দেখা যাচ্ছে যে আমাকে সিউডো-টার্মিনাল থেকে মূল হিসাবে VBoxLinuxAdditions.run চালাতে হয়েছিল এবং এটি ঠিক করতে পুনরায় বুট করতে হবে।

এফওয়াইআই এর ক্ষেত্রে যদি কেউ বাইরে থাকে তবে একই সমস্যা আছে।

ডেভিড

আমাদের সাইট ব্যবহার করে, আপনি স্বীকার করেছেন যে আপনি আমাদের কুকি নীতি এবং গোপনীয়তা নীতিটি পড়েছেন এবং বুঝতে পেরেছেন ।
Licensed under cc by-sa 3.0 with attribution required.